Checklist item 7 — Pool car key cabinet. Walk the new starter to the facilities desk on the ground floor of Merrow Court and show them the grey key cabinet beside the post room. Explain that pool car keys must be signed out in the ledger, with return time noted, and that keys are never taken home overnight. Confirm they understand fuel cards stay with the vehicle. Once the ledger entry is complete, issue them the cabinet access code below.

staff pass of yagep-tajep = bdg-TRT-1

Team,

As discussed at Monday's sync, the executive group has reviewed the joint venture proposal with Kestrelmark Industrial. Terms cover co-branded distribution across the Averlyn corridor, with a 60/40 revenue split in our favour for year one. Sales leads should hold off on committing regional accounts until structure is finalised. Legal expects a draft agreement within three weeks. Questions can go through your regional director. The confidential note on our broader plans follows directly below.

Regards,
Marta

board note of baweg-bawig: Project Tamath slips by six weeks because of the audit delay.

### Ticket: Order-cutoff drift on Crumbery prod

The Crumbery bakery service enforces a daily order cutoff, after which next-day orders roll forward. Production has drifted from the values in the repo — cutoff fires an hour early, likely a timezone mismatch introduced during the last manual hotfix. Please reconcile against the intended configuration, reproduced below.

config for yawep-tajef:
[kelion]
team = kelys
access_code = ac_1a130d
owner = holax.aldmir
host = kelion.urlaqforge.example
port = 9090
peer = fenmir.lumicio.example
salt = d0dd3cb5
pin = 3295

### Night-Shift Access — Support Team

Contractors working after 22:00 at Dowell Point enter via the east stairwell only. Sign the night register at the support-team hatch and wait for an escort to Level 2. The stairwell door uses the keypad code below.

turnstile pass: bdg-FVNQRS-72965873